3.17 DC Load Simulation -- Timing Mode

Timing Mode can be executed CC, CR, CP, CV and Rectified mode under the DC mode.
The timer starts after Load ON. There are three different conditions for the times to stop. 1.
Load OFF. 2. The UUT voltage drops below the cutoff voltage setting. 3. The timer has
reached the time set.
